When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ired

Is the level of comfort in your home dis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if disregarded, could cause more severe repairs or the requirement for an early replacement of your ac system. While a system that will not turn on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you are familiar with the more subtle signs of a issue with your a/c, you will be able to call a professional service professional earlier instead of later.

If any of the following use, one of our Missouri AC repair specialists recommends that you give us a call:

  • You are sustaining an increase in the quantity of cash needed to pay for your monthly utility costs: Inefficient operation of your air conditioning system can be brought on by a variety of different concerns, including leaking 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a defective thermostat. This means that it needs to work more difficult to keep your residential or commercial property cool, which will lead to a substantial increase in the amount that you pay in utility expenses.
  • You just disc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make sure you have not unintentionally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by inspecting it. If that is not the case, then you most likely have a issue on the inside of your ac system, and you must get it inspected by a professional.
  • You are seeing a higher hum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the primary function of your air conditioning system, it is responsible for regulating the humidity level inside of your home or industrial building. Greater humidity shows that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can result in the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is essential that you get this matter resolved as quickly as humanly possible, especially for the sake of your safety.
  • The air flow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ide range of factors that can result in insufficient airflow. We will need to carry out a comprehensive inspection in order to find out whether the problem is the outcome of a stopped up air filter, an problem with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or blocked air ducts.
  • You observe that there is a considerable amount of moisture in the area around your system: Condensation is a natural event, nevertheless it shouldn’t be present in excessive qu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a clogged drain tube if you observe any excess wetness or pooling water in the location.
  • Strange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an ac system to develop some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an obvious indication that something requires to be repaired.
  • It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your air conditioner. If you have cold and hot areas around your home, your system will not sh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your unit will not begin, it might likewise be because it will not turn off.
  • Foul odors are originating from your system: There might be a issue with your air conditioner if you smell anything burning or a moldy odor. These smells can be triggered by a variety of factors, consisting of mold development and charred electrical wiring.
  • Your system turns typically between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have actually picked on the thermostat, a/c unit are configured to switch off automatically. Despite this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ises

There are a few noises that ought to not be heard originating from a/c despite the fact that they do not operate in full sil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king sound. These specific sounds almost always indicate that there is a problem within the air conditioning system that has to be repaired by a professional of in Jackson County.

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your a/c The following ought to be included:

  • Banging: The problem is generally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ging sound. This component of the a/c is responsible for delivering refrigerant to the different other parts of the unit in order to get rid of excess heat from your home. Compressor components might relax as the air conditioning system ages. This noise is triggered by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
  • Screeching: A broken blower fan motor within the a/c unit might produce a sound similar to shrieking or squealing if the motor is working incorrectly. Usually, a malfunctioning f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Shut off the a/c right now and get in touch with a expert for repair work whenever you hear a screeching noise.
  •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never a good sign to hear coming from any kind of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or may have worn, which might result in this grinding sound emanating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it almost always shows that the compressor itself needs to be changed. The complete AC system could require to be replaced depending on the model of air conditioner and how old it is.
  • Clicking: It is very typical for an ac system to make a clicking noise when it at first swit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ole duration of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working properly.
